DIY


Concise Oxford English Dictionary © 2008 Oxford University Press:
DIY/diːʌɪˈwʌɪ/
noun chiefly Brit. the activity of decorating and making fixtures and repairs in the home oneself rather than employing a professional.
– derivatives
DIY'er noun.
– origin 1950s: abbrev. of do-it-yourself.
